The Pooh tattoo idea captures the essence of childhood innocence and whimsical adventures through beloved characters from A,A, Milne's stories, Typically, a Pooh tattoo depicts the lovable bear himself, often alongside his friends like Piglet, Tigger, or Eeyore, set against an idyllic backdrop of the Hundred Acre Wood, This tattoo concept serves as a celebration of friendship, love, and the simple joys of life, embodying that playful spirit in various design options, As with many tattoo ideas, a Pooh tattoo resonates with those who cherish nostalgia or have a personal connection to these timeless characters, Originating from British literature in the early 20th century, the stories of Winnie the Pooh have gone on to influence countless generations across the globe, The tattoo idea draws from the enchanting world crafted by Milne, where imagination reigns and adventures are abundant, With so many fans of the original stories and subsequent adaptations in film and media, the Pooh tattoo continues to gain popularity, symbolizing not just a character, but also a fond reminder of cherished childhood memories, The meaning embedded in Pooh tattoos transcends mere imagery; they often represent themes of friendship, loyalty, and the importance of enjoying life’s little moments, Pooh himself embodies a carefree, gentle spirit, leading many to adopt this tattoo idea as a tribute to self-acceptance and happiness, Cultural interpretations may also vary, with some connecting Pooh to values of simplicity and companionship, while others view the imagery as a reminder to stay childlike in spirit amidst life’s complexities, When it comes to artwork styles that suit the Pooh tattoo idea, neo-traditional and watercolor are particularly popular, Neo-traditional tattoos offer a vibrant palette and bold outlines that can beautifully capture the playful essence of Pooh and his companions, Watercolor tattoos, on the other hand, bring a dreamy, fluid quality to the design, echoing the whimsical nature of the stories and enhancing the visual appeal with splashes of color that seem to float.
Additionally, minimalistic options provide a clean and modern take on the beloved characters, allowing for understated elegance, For those considering a Pooh tattoo idea, placements vary from larger canvas areas to more discreet locations, The upper arm and back are ideal for more extensive designs featuring multiple characters or scenes from the Hundred Acre Wood, allowing for intricate detailing, Smaller, minimalist versions can be placed on the wrist, ankle, or behind the ear, where they can be both personal and easily concealed, making these areas suitable for those who prefer more subtle tattoo ideas, Variations of the Pooh tattoo idea are as diverse as the fans themselves, Some may opt for a humorous twist by depicting Pooh in unexpected settings, like dressed in modern attire or performing silly actions, Others might choose to incorporate meaningful quotes from the stories, adding a layer of personal significance to the design, Artistic interpretations can range from cartoonish and playful to more realistic and stylized designs, providing room for innovation that reflects the wearer’s personality, These adaptations allow for endless creativity, as tattoo artists can infuse their own style and perspective into the classic characters, In conclusion, the Pooh tattoo idea serves as a wonderful blend of nostalgia and creativity, making it a favorite among tattoo enthusiasts, The combination of rich historical context, multi-layered meanings, and an array of artistic styles ensures that Pooh tattoos will continue to inspire joy and connection for those who choose to wear them, Such tattoo ideas not only evoke fond memories but also allow for personal expression through beloved literary characters, creatively bridging the gap between childhood wonder and adult individuality.
